HIP 50615

HIP 50615 is a A-type (White) star.

At a distance of roughly 2,398 light-years, HIP 50615 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 50615 is classified as a spectral class A star (A-type (White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

At an apparent magnitude of +10.25, HIP 50615 is a faint star that requires a telescope to observe. It is invisible to the naked eye and too dim for most binoculars. Observers will note its yellow h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.906.
